Fort Cobb Vs. Oklahoma Carpentry Employment
| Fort Cobb | 160 |
| Oklahoma | 6,850 |
Exactly 160 of the 6,850 carpentry professionals employed in Oklahoma, work in Fort Cobb. The number of carpentry professionals in Fort Cobb has shrunk by 38% from 2006 to 2010. As the employment for carpentry professionals in Fort Cobb has decreased, overall employment in Fort Cobb has also decreased.

Salaries for carpentry professionals in Fort Cobb have increased. In 2010 an average salary of $29,750 per year was earned by carpentry professionals in Fort Cobb. The average salary for carpentry professionals in Fort Cobb was $25,360 per year, four years earlier in 2006. The growth in the salary of carpentry professionals in Fort Cobb is faster than the salary trend for all careers in the city.

Carpentry professionals in Fort Cobb make a median yearly salary of $28,840. The difference in pay between the carpentry professionals in the lowest pay bracket and those in the highest pay bracket is approximately 84%. Those in the lowest 10% of the pay bracket earn less than $21,620 per year, while those in the highest 10% of the pay bracket earn more than $39,750 per year.
